Gallup perception survey irks FBR

Published July 6, 2007 Updated July 6, 2007 12:00am

The Federal Board of Revenue (FBR) has raised objections on the perception survey being conducted by the Gallup Pakistan for obtaining the viewpoint of taxpayers and government departments about the integrity of the FBR employees.
Some of the tax officials criticised the outcome of survey relating to performance of large taxpayers units and correction in the field formation. It was claimed in the survey that the corruption marginally reduce and secondly certain tax payers are not satisfied by the services provided by the LTU.
